The surround sound headphone technology is now available in several Samsung TV models.
Samsung has announced the addition of DTS Headphone:X support to its recently launched HD and Ultra HD display collection. The technology is currently available on a total of 44 Samsung televisions.
DTS Headphone:X on Samsung TVs allows users to listen to surround sound content on any pair of wireless Bluetooth headphones. The technology will send 5.1 audio tracks over Bluetooth to a customer's headphones from most content sources connected to or integrated in the TV, including Blu-rays, streaming services, and game consoles. In addition, Headphone:X also enhances regular stereo content as well. For impressions of the 11.1 surround sound implementation of the technology, check out our DTS:X Home Theater Guide.
The current list of Samsung displays with DTS Headphone:X support includes the majority of the company's recently released 2015 Ultra HD models.
